Output 5d6acf259e30d1097b7d84f29f765e0abfa0dece8fc9589fefc0ef327a2c271d:1

value
31504544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8202853644f7572b9291f4a088e3d72b0caa42a0 OP_EQUAL
address
3DYSnbiT4NDbBvavvWwLDxeSRhsnmHB6Wu
transaction
5d6acf259e30d1097b7d84f29f765e0abfa0dece8fc9589fefc0ef327a2c271d
confirmations
385785
spent
true